Interest Expense is the amount reported by a company or individual as an expense for borrowed money.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ment's interest expense for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was 円 -81 Mil. Its interest expense for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was 円-159 Mil.

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income(EBIT) by its Interest Expense.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ment's Operating Income for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was 円 414 Mil.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ment's Interest Expense for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was 円 -81 Mil.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ment's Interest Coverage for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was 5.13. The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is.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ment's Interest Expense for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was 円-81 Mil. Its Operating Income for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was 円414 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was 円10,771 Mil.

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ment's Interest Coverage for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(Q: Dec. 2025 )/Interest Expense (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=-1*414.374/-80.845
=5.13

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ment Business Description

Address 2-3 Kojimachi, 8th floor, Kojimachi Place, Chiyoda-ku, Tokyo, JPN
Tokyo Infrastructure Energy Investment Corp is a Japan-based investment corporation. The company mainly invests in renewable energy generation equipment related assets. Its investment objective is to maximize the investor's value by creating high-quality investment opportunities and at the same time achieves the government's goal of promoting renewable energy power generation and revitalizes the local community. Its portfolio consists of TI Ryugasaki Solar Power Station, TI Ushisa Solar Power Station, TI Kanuma Solar Power Station, TI Yabuki Solar Power Station, and TI Kushiro Solar Power Station.
